December 2022 by Shawnie P.
One of the reasons I love Tiktok is because I get great ideas on new places to visit. I saw a clip on cool places to check out yesterday and realized this spot was only 15 minutes from my house so I decided to go today. They have the latest vintage fashions with tons of different categories and sizes. This is a decent size warehouse located in Hialeah Gardens, FL. Easy to find and not far from the Palmetto Hwy. They have many bins full of all types of clothing ranging from $3 - $15 for most items. They also have several racks of hanging clothing with price tags ranging from $10 - $40+. They also have accessories like hats, shoes, belts, and more. I was happy to see they have a vintage comic book selection as well.I liked the vintage decor and openness of this place. Open, airy and laid back. There is also plenty of free parking. They offer dressing room areas, bathrooms and a member discount for being a repeat customer. You can purchase vintage and retro clothing in bulk or by the piece. You'll love this place if you grew up shopping Salvation Army and Goodwill.I bought some comic books (4) as a gift for my nephew and a sesshomaru vintage tie dye tee for myself. I paid a total of $25. Not bad. My husband pointed out the large strobe lights around the ceiling area along with a big disco ball in the center of the ceiling stating "I think this place turns into a club at night." Intrigued, I asked the guy working there and he confirmed that starting in January, it will be a hang out spot with music & food vendors. I enjoyed my visit and glad I came here today. Check them out if you're in the south Florida area.

November 2022 by Alexa C.
It's about time that Hialeah had a reputable thrifting source full of varied goods of past remnants in impeccable condition awaiting to be upcycled. Located in a non-descript warehouse alongside the Palmetto Expressway is where you'll find this plethora of thrifts priced quite attractively in multiple categories and separated depending on your budget. It's got a look unlike other thrift stores as the front is staged with several items that aren't listed for sale but add to the appeal of the crowd they cater to. I just have taken a hundred pictures of that circular table in the front because I absolutely adore it. I love coming here and finding old concert tees along with high rise denim bottoms in cuts that just aren't available nowadays. Their Harley-Davidson section is hard to compete against and I even scored some pillow sheets for my uncle which I'm sure he appreciated. They also have the bins priced per pound so you can go "dumpster-diving" in preselected and sorted bins for an even better deal. The staff is so friendly which makes shopping here even more enjoyable. I love everything they stand for and I'm a loyal customer of this super neat thrift store. I've gotten many compliments on blouses I've purchased here for work. They are closed on mondays and tuesdays is when they showcase their new inventory so that's certainly the best day to come. Signing up for their rewards system let's you earn points and keep track of your receipts which give you incentives redeemable on future purchases.
